First, Find Pak Kumis: The Man with the Plans

You cannot simply buy an expansion from a menu. The option to upgrade your restaurant is tied directly to a key non-player character (NPC): Pak Kumis, the local carpenter. Before you can even think about construction, you need to find him and get on his good side.

Where to Find Pak Kumis

Pak Kumis is typically found in the newer, more developed section of the town, often near his workshop or a visible construction project. Look for a character model with woodworking tools or a distinctive mustache (kumis is Indonesian for mustache). He is usually available during daytime hours.

The Introductory Quest: Proving Your Worth

Pak Kumis won't offer to renovate your restaurant for a stranger. When you first interact with him, he will have a problem that needs solving. This usually takes the form of an introductory quest, such as:

  • Repairing his broken cart: He may ask you to fetch specific materials like wood, nails, or a specialty part from another vendor in town.
  • Running an errand: He might need a specific food item or a tool delivered to him.

Completing this initial task is mandatory. Only after you have helped him will the dialogue option to discuss renovating your restaurant (often labeled "Renovasi") become available. Do not neglect this step; you cannot proceed without it.

The First Restaurant Expansion: Doubling Your Footprint

Once you've helped Pak Kumis, you can begin the first major upgrade. This expansion focuses on extending the ground floor of your restaurant, effectively doubling your initial seating capacity and streamlining your kitchen workflow. This is a critical step for moving beyond the early-game grind.

Step 1: Trigger the "Renovasi" Quest

Return to Pak Kumis and select the dialogue option to discuss upgrading your restaurant. He will lay out the terms: a hefty fee and a list of required materials. This formally begins the expansion quest. He will not start work until you have gathered everything and have the full payment ready.

Step 2: Meet the Steep Requirements

This first upgrade is designed to be your first major financial goal in the game. You will need to save up a considerable amount of cash and potentially source some raw materials. While exact numbers can vary with game patches, the requirements are typically in this range:

RequirementEstimated Amount/Type
Cash (Rupiah)Rp 2,500,000 - Rp 5,000,000
Materials20x Wood Planks, 10x Box of Nails
PrerequisiteCompleted Pak Kumis's introductory quest.

Pro Tip: Start saving early. As soon as you establish a steady daily income, begin setting aside at least 30% of your profits specifically for this expansion. Don't spend it all on decorations or minor upgrades that won't increase your customer throughput.

Step 3: The Payoff and What to Do Next

After delivering the materials and the payment, the construction will happen automatically, usually overnight. The next day, you'll find your restaurant has a new wing. This upgrade typically adds:

  • Space for 4-6 additional tables, potentially doubling your capacity.
  • An expanded kitchen area, giving you more room to place new equipment.
  • New wall space for decorations that can boost your restaurant's rating.

Immediately buy new tables and chairs to fill the new space. An empty expansion earns you nothing. Your top priority should be getting more customers seated and served to start capitalizing on your investment.

The Second Floor: Becoming a Bakso Tycoon

The ultimate status symbol in Bakso Simulator 2 is the second-floor expansion. This transforms your restaurant from a successful street-side stall into a true culinary destination. The cost and effort are immense, but the reward is a business that can generate money faster than you can count it. The Steam achievement "Insane Restaurant Upgrade!" is tied to this level of investment.

Step 1: Unlocking the "Lantai Dua" Quest

The second-floor expansion isn't immediately available after the first. To unlock the quest (often called "Lantai Dua," meaning Second Floor), you typically need to meet several conditions:

  • Complete the first restaurant expansion.
  • Reach a high restaurant rating (e.g., 4 or 4.5 stars).
  • Potentially complete another, smaller quest for Pak Kumis to further the storyline.

Once these are met, Pak Kumis will offer you the ambitious project of building a second story. This is the game's primary endgame money sink.

Step 2: The Staggering Cost of Going Vertical

If you thought the first expansion was expensive, prepare yourself. The second floor costs exponentially more, solidifying its status as a late-game objective. This upgrade is a massive undertaking.

RequirementEstimated Amount/Type
Cash (Rupiah)Rp 15,000,000 - Rp 25,000,000
Materials50x Quality Wood, 20x Steel Beams, 10x Bags of Cement
PrerequisiteHigh restaurant rating and first expansion complete.

These advanced materials may not be available at the standard hardware store and might require you to unlock a new supplier or complete other side quests to source them.

Step 3: Managing a Two-Story Empire

Completing the second-floor expansion is a game-changer. You gain a massive new dining area, often with a different aesthetic, allowing you to cater to a huge number of customers. However, this also introduces new management challenges:

  • Staffing: You will absolutely need to hire and train additional staff to cover both floors efficiently. A single waiter cannot handle a two-story building.
  • Customer Flow: Customers will now walk upstairs, which can create bottlenecks. A smart layout is crucial to ensure staff can move between floors and the kitchen quickly.
  • Kitchen Upgrades: Your base-level cooking equipment will not be able to keep up with the demand from two floors of customers. You must invest in the best cooktops and other gear to maintain service speed.

Is Expanding Your Restaurant Worth It?

Unequivocally, yes. While the upfront costs are daunting, expanding your restaurant is the primary way to break through income plateaus in Bakso Simulator 2. Each upgrade directly increases your earning potential by allowing more customers to be served simultaneously.

  • The Pros: A larger restaurant leads to a higher customer cap, which translates directly to more daily revenue. It also unlocks the ability to use more decorations, which boosts your restaurant rating and attracts higher-paying customer types.

  • The Cons: The cost is the main drawback. Spending millions on a renovation can leave you cash-poor and unable to afford supplies or deal with emergencies. Furthermore, a larger space is harder to manage, requiring more staff and creating more potential for chaos if not run efficiently.

Ultimately, the goal isn't just to expand, but to expand smartly. Never upgrade until you have enough reserve cash to fully furnish the new space and handle at least two days of operating expenses.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Why won't Pak Kumis offer me the expansion quest?

A: You most likely haven't completed his initial introductory quest. Find him and see if he has a task for you, like fixing his cart or fetching an item. You must help him before business discussions can begin.

Q: What is the fastest way to earn money for the restaurant expansion?

A: Focus on upgrading your recipes and your chef's cooking speed first. Serving higher-quality bakso to more people per day is the most reliable income stream. Avoid risky gambles at the arcade. Complete side quests offered by other townsfolk for quick cash boosts.

Q: Can you expand the restaurant more than twice?

A: As of the current version, the main questline allows for two major structural expansions: the ground floor extension and the second-floor addition. Further customization comes from buying new furniture, decorations, and equipment rather than more construction.
